NGUI and Minimap draw question

Hello,

I have a simple minimap implemented by using an ortographic camera. Also I have a tooltip impemented in NGUI. Sometimes the tooltip description text and label overlaps the minimap area on my screen, but the minimap is always in front, so it makes impossible to read the tooltip.

Is there a way to push the tooltip in front of the minimap ?

you need to add a NGUI Widget as render target (needs Unity pro) for your $$anonymous$$inimap camera view. That way the $$anonymous$$inimap is shown as part of the NGUI System. Now you can adjust the $$anonymous$$inimap and tooltip layer with the Depth System of NGUI.

In case other people are looking to solve this particular problem, the solution is to change the draw level (the value that determines which camera is drawn first)of the GUI camera to 60.

it isnt necessarily 60 for everyone. The higher the depth, object will appear above an object with a lower depth
